Swedish truckers set for strike over wages

Swedish Transport Union members are set to go on strike from noon Wednesday after wage talks crumbled, leaving employers warning the truck drivers of a lockout by Thursday.

Canada Cartage appoints new vice-president of IT

TORONTO, Ont. — Canada Cartage has appointed Daniel Roy as vice-president of Information Technology (IT). He will be responsible for leading the growth and strategic development of IT projects nationwide for Canada Cartage.
